The Evolution of Live‑Dealer Gaming
Live‑dealer gaming began as a novelty experiment in the 1990s when a handful of European operators aired roulette via satellite television. Players called a premium phone line to place bets while a studio audience watched a dealer spin the wheel on a TV screen. The latency was high, the graphics were grainy, and the cost per seat was prohibitive, limiting the model to high‑rollers.
The next leap arrived with broadband internet and flash‑based interfaces in the early 2010s. High‑definition cameras captured every chip movement, and a responsive betting window allowed wagers to be placed in milliseconds. Operators could now stream from modest studios in Malta or Gibraltar, reducing rent and travel costs while expanding the player base to casual users seeking a “real” feel.
A further milestone emerged when 4K streaming and low‑latency protocols entered the market. Real‑time video compression algorithms lowered bandwidth consumption, and integrated payment gateways—now even accepting crypto payments—streamlined the wagering process. Each technological advance trimmed certain expense categories but introduced new ones, such as sophisticated anti‑lag monitoring and higher licensing fees for ultra‑high‑definition content.
The cumulative effect is a live‑dealer ecosystem that feels authentic, yet operates on a cost structure far more complex than that of a traditional slot‑only online casino.
Unpacking the Cost Structure: From Dealer Salaries to Bandwidth
Live‑dealer operators must balance a multitude of expense streams to keep the tables running smoothly. The most visible cost is staff wages: dealers, floor managers, and compliance officers command salaries comparable to their land‑based counterparts, often supplemented by performance bonuses tied to table turnover.
Studio rent represents the second major outlay. A purpose‑built studio equipped with multiple camera rigs, sound‑proofing, and lighting can cost anywhere from $5,000 to $15,000 per month, depending on location. Equipment depreciation—high‑speed cameras, PTZ lenses, and secure card‑reading devices—adds another 8‑10 % to the budget each year.
Licensing fees have risen sharply as regulators demand separate approvals for live‑dealer streams, data encryption, and cross‑border wagering. In jurisdictions such as the United Kingdom and Malta, operators pay a percentage of gross gaming revenue (GGR) on top of a fixed annual levy.
Data transmission is the hidden beast. Streaming a 1080p feed at 30 fps consumes roughly 3 GB per hour per player. When multiplied by thousands of concurrent users, bandwidth costs can eclipse traditional server‑hosting expenses. Operators mitigate this by partnering with content‑delivery networks (CDNs) that cache streams close to the end‑user, but the fees remain significant.
Below is a conceptual table illustrating typical percentage allocations for a mid‑size live‑dealer operation:
| Expense Category | Approx. % of Total Cost |
|---|---|
| Dealer & staff wages | 30 % |
| Studio rent & utilities | 20 % |
| Equipment purchase & depreciation | 12 % |
| Licensing & regulatory fees | 15 % |
| Bandwidth & CDN services | 13 % |
| Miscellaneous (marketing, compliance) | 10 % |
Compared with a brick‑and‑mortar casino, live‑dealer platforms shift a large portion of overhead from physical floor space to digital infrastructure, while still retaining the human element that drives player engagement.

Technological Advances That Reduce Hidden Expenses
AI‑assisted dealer monitoring is reshaping the cost equation. Machine‑learning algorithms can detect irregular chip movements, verify card shuffles, and flag potential fraud in real time, reducing the need for extensive human oversight. This automation cuts staffing costs by up to 15 % while preserving game integrity.
Virtual studio environments are another breakthrough. Instead of renting physical space, operators now use green‑screen technology combined with photorealistic 3D rendering to create a “digital casino floor.” Dealers sit in a modest control room, and the background is generated in post‑production, slashing rent and utility expenses dramatically.
Cloud‑based streaming platforms further trim bandwidth overhead. By leveraging edge computing, video streams are processed closer to the end‑user, decreasing latency and the amount of data transmitted. Operators can switch from a fixed‑rate CDN contract to a pay‑as‑you‑go model, aligning costs directly with player traffic.
Looking ahead, mixed‑reality (MR) dealers—where a holographic dealer appears on a player’s AR headset—promise to blend physical presence with virtual efficiency. Early pilots suggest that MR could reduce studio space requirements by up to 40 %, though the initial hardware investment remains high. As the technology matures, the cost savings are expected to flow back to players in the form of tighter margins and potentially higher RTPs.
